<p style="padding-left: 30px;"><span style="color: #0000ff;"> <span style="color: #0000ff;">While Pakistan may have pitched hard with the US for early transfer of F-16 fighter aircraft and other sophisticated     military equipment, a concerned India is learnt to have raised the stakes by indicating to the US that such a     transfer may not go down well at a time when two US companies are bidding for the 126 multi-role combat aircraft tender floated by India.</span></span></p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;"><span style="color: #0000ff;">This $10 billion-plus tender is considered one of the biggest international military contracts in the world now. At     present, six companies are in the fray: F-16 from Lockheed Martin (US), Boeing’s F-18 SH (US), Eurofighter from a     European consortium, the Rafale from France, the Swedish Gripen, and Russian Mig-35.</span></p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;"><span style="color: #0000ff;">Most trials are over with the IAF planning to shortlist contenders on the basis of their performance in the next few     months.</span></p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;"><span style="color: #0000ff;">Pakistan has been in negotiations with the US on obtaining 18 F-16s for the past few years. However, this has been     riddled by fears of it being used only to strengthen its military capabilities against India and not justifiably     needed in the war against terror. </span></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><span style="color: #0000ff;">India on Sunday successfully tested the Agni 3 nuclear missile for the third time, indicating its readiness for induction into the strategic forces. The third successful test, which came after the initial setback in 2006 when the missile plunged into the Bay of Bengal, is part of the pre-induction trial of the missile that gives India for the first time the capability to strike deep into China.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#0000ff;"><a href="http://philip9876.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/agni-3.jpg"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-4007" title="agni-3" src="http://philip9876.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/agni-3.jpg" alt="" width="360" height="265" /></a>The Agni 3 test, which took place from the Wheeler Island off the Orissa coast, has made the missile ready for induction, the Defence Ministry announced on Sunday. “The launch is part of the pre-induction trial. The Indian Army (the user) has carried out the total launch operations guided by the Defence Reseach and Development Organisation (DRDO) scientists. Now the Missile system will be fully inducted into the Armed Forces,” a statement by the Defence Ministry said.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#0000ff;"><a href="http://philip9876.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/AGNI-3-range.gif"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-4011" title="AGNI-3 range" src="http://philip9876.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/AGNI-3-range.gif" alt="" width="650" height="544" /></a><br />
</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#0000ff;">While the formal induction will take at least two more years and a few more tests, the missile is strategically vital in India’s nuclear deterrence plans that rely on the second strike theory. India’s stated policy has been of no first use, which makes it vital to have long range missiles to strike back in the event of a nuclear attack.</span></p>
